Description

Accounts of a druggist, probably. On a bifolium. In Arabic script with a few Greek/Coptic numerals (but mainly the numbers are spelled out). Dating: Perhaps 12th or 13th century, but that is a guess. Two of the pages are headed "bayān al-X." On the lower right of recto, people are purchasing violets (zahr banafsaj). Numerous names are mentioned, including al-ʿAmīd, al-Makīn Abū Isḥāq, Ḥassūn the ghulām of Mawhūb, ʿAlī b. al-Raqqī, ʿAbd al-Bāqī, Abū l-Ḥasan al-Qifṭī, Muḥammad al-Ṣaghīr, Ibn al-Ṭaffāl, ʿAbdallāh al-Ṣiqillī, Ibrāhīm al-Dallāṣī, Abū l-Karam the in-law of al-Shammāʿ, Yūsuf al-Shammāʿ, Abū l-Ḥasan al-ʿAbd (the slave?), and Bū Yūsuf(?) b. Abū l-Faḍl.
